May 2025 - Apr 2026Foster Road area has the 6th lowest crime rate of 34 local areas in Trumpington , and the 70th lowest crime rate of 395 local areas in Cambridge .
This postcode forms a relatively safe pocket compared with the surrounding streets. Neighbouring areas record much higher crime levels, even though this postcode itself remains comparatively low-crime.
The overall crime rate in the area around Foster Road (CB2 9JN) in the last 12 months was 27.9 per 1,000 residents and was 60.0% lower than the Trumpington average (69.8 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 6 offences recorded. The least common crime was Anti-social behaviour with 1 case , unchanged from 2025. The fastest-growing crime category was Criminal damage and arson ( 100.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Violence and sexual offences ( -14.3% YoY).
Violent crimes totalled 6 (≈ 14.0 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were falling ( -14.3%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-90.9%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around Foster Road (CB2 9JN), the main crime hotspot is near Anstey Way. Police recorded 23 crimes here, including 11 violent or public-order offences. All these locations are within roughly 0.3 miles.
